Puis-je voir la valeur de L'État de Session côté client en utilisant Chrome DevTools?

j'étais juste curieux de savoir si nous pouvions obtenir/voir les valeurs des variables de Session pour un site Web en utilisant Chrome DevTools.

si quelqu'un le sait, partagez.

21
demandé sur Win 2013-11-13 18:52:19

3 réponses

Non, vous ne pouvez pas voir les variables d'état de session côté client. L'état de la Session est stocké sur le serveur, et le navigateur Client ne connaît SessionID que qui est stocké dans un cookie ou une URL.

ASP.NET l'État de la Session Présentation

les Sessions sont identifiés par un identifiant unique qui peut être lu par utilisation de la propriété SessionID. Lorsque l'état de session est activé pour un ASP.NET demande, chaque demande pour une page dans la demande est examiné pour une valeur de SessionID envoyée par le navigateur. Si aucun id de session la valeur est fournie, ASP.NET commence une nouvelle session et le SessionID la valeur pour cette session est envoyée au navigateur avec la réponse.

par défaut, les valeurs de SessionID sont stockées dans un cookie. Cependant, vous pouvez configurer également l'application pour stocker les valeurs de SessionID dans L'URL pour un "cookieless" session.

le navigateur Chrome a quelques extensions pour afficher le cookie. J'utilise Edit This Cookie.

enter image description here

31
répondu Win 2013-11-13 15:30:33

la Session est maintenue côté serveur. Vous pouvez visualiser les cookies avec les identifiants de session côté client. donc chrome vous aidera à cela seulement.

si vous utilisez le serveur apache, le fichier avec le même nom que la session peut être trouvé sur le serveur et toutes les variables peuvent être vérifiées.

6
répondu Anand Shah 2013-11-13 14:56:18

si vous êtes sur ASP.NET vous pourriez utiliser Glimpse, un "inspecteur" côté client qui superpose votre page Web et vous montre ce qui se passe du côté serveur. C'est génial, et la bibliothèque de plugins le rend encore plus agréable de voir d'autres choses comme les requêtes de DB la page faite et ainsi de suite.

http://getglimpse.com/

0
répondu benmccallum 2018-03-09 10:16:26